#075842 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#075842 is composed of 2.7% red, 34.5%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 163.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 18.6%. #075842 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eb084 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#075842 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#075842 has RGB values of R:7, G:88,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 481346.

Shades and Tints of #075842
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f0b is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#075842
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f3030 is the less saturated color, while #035c44 is the most saturated one.
